Inspection History
Jul 22, 2022
Food-Licensing Inspection
No violations found.
100
Jul 18, 2022
Food-Licensing Inspection
2 major violations. 2 minor violations.
View 4 violations
Intermediate - No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. Server area .
31B-02-4
Intermediate - No soap provided at handwash sink. Server area.
31B-03-4
Basic - Ceiling not smooth, nonabsorbent and easily cleanable in food preparation, food storage, or warewashing areas. Part of the kitchen is missing smooth and cleanable tile. Old tile not at specification to plan review is still installed. Operator will install corrected tile within 60 days.
36-37-5
Basic - No drainboards or equivalent provided for soiled items and/or air drying cleaned items. Three compartment missing drain board.
16-04-4
